What is CVE-2026-71292?

The Subrion CMS's admin grid sorting helper is vulnerable to SQL injection due to improper handling of request parameters. When the expected sorting key is not found in the whitelist, it defaults to using the raw sort GET parameter, which allows an authenticated attacker to manipulate database queries. This flawed implementation can lead to the unauthorized disclosure of sensitive information, including administrator password hashes. The exploitability of this vulnerability is exacerbated by the presence of inadequate or absent whitelisting across various admin grid controllers.

Affected Version(s)

subrion 0 <= 4.2.1
